Secret Operations of a Titration Testing Center
Titration testing centers follow a systematic method to performing titrations. Below are the common operations within such facilities:

Sample Collection
Collection of samples ensuring minimal contamination.Proper labeling and documentation for traceability.
Preparation of Reagents
Picking proper titrants and reagents.Ensuring chemicals are of analytical grade.
Standardization of Solutions
Standardizing the concentration of the titrant.Carrying out preliminary tests to verify outcomes.
Performing the Titration
Performing the Titration Mental Health under regulated conditions.Using numerous types of titrations based on the analyte:Titration TypeDescriptionAcid-BaseUses an acid or base as the titrant to determine pH changes.RedoxIncludes oxidation-reduction reactions.ComplexometricUses complexing agents to analyze metal ions.PrecipitationInvolves the development of a precipitate to identify concentration.

Common Industries Utilizing Titration Testing Centers
Several markets depend upon the services provided by titration testing centers, consisting of:

Pharmaceuticals: To determine the concentration of active pharmaceutical active ingredients.

Food and Beverage: To evaluate level of acidity levels, preservatives, and nutritional material.

Environmental Testing: Monitoring the pollution levels in water sources and soil through the analysis of heavy metals and other harmful contaminants.

Education and Academia: Used in chemistry education to teach trainees about analytical techniques and laboratory skills.
